After meeting Priyanka Gandhi, Sanjay Raut said - 'There may be an alliance in UP, Goa'
Shiv Sena MP Sanjay Raut has indicated an alliance with the Congress party in the Uttar Pradesh and Goa assembly elections after meeting Priyanka Gandhi. Shiv Sena is already running a successful government in Maharashtra in alliance with Congress and NCP.

Sanjay Raut met Congress leader Priyanka Gandhi in Delhi on Wednesday 8 December. Earlier, Sanjay Raut has also met Rahul Gandhi in Delhi.
Sanjay Raut had said after meeting Rahul Gandhi in Delhi that there cannot be an opposition without the Congress party. The Shiv Sena, which is running the government in Maharashtra with the support of the Congress party, seems to be standing firmly with the Congress.
